What is the best way to pay for Huobi Token (HT)?
The simplest way to buy Huobi Token cryptocurrency is with your bank card. However, there are plenty of other options as well. Here are some of the top ways to pay for HT.
- Buy Huobi Token with a credit card or debit card. Card payments are convenient and instantaneous but you may have to pay a higher fee to make a deposit this way. Binance charges 1.8% for a card deposit and some platforms charge as much as 4%.
- Buy Huobi Token with bank transfer. A bank transfer is usually the cheapest way to buy crypto. Crypto platforms like Crypto.com and Coinbase do not charge for bank transfer deposits, while Binance only charges a £1 fee, and these transactions are more or less instant as they run through the Faster Payments System (FPS).
- Buy Huobi Token with PayPal. Some crypto brokers accept deposits via PayPal. eToro is the best option because it doesn’t charge a fee for PayPal deposits, whereas the charge can be as high as 5% or more with other platforms.
- Alternative payment methods. Crypto brokers often let you pay with other providers or money transfer services, like Neteller, Venmo, or Payoneer. The options vary by broker, though, so check what’s accepted before you sign up.
How do I store Huobi Token (HT)?
Most people keep their crypto on the exchange they used to buy it. If you only plan to hold onto it for a little while then that’s a perfectly acceptable option. If you want to hold it for years or you own a lot of Huobi Token then you should move it to a crypto wallet.
A crypto exchange is similar to a bank account, in that it means trusting a company to protect your funds for you. A wallet is like your personal wallet, or a safe, where you take responsibility for it yourself. Two of the best Huobi Token wallets to use are MetaMask and the Ledger Nano S.
Is Huobi Token (HT) a good investment?
Whether it’s good for you depends on your goals and the fundamentals of the project. Here are some key features of Huobi Token and its token to help you decide whether to invest in HT.
- Offers discounts on trading fees. Holders of Huobi Token can receive discounts on trading fees. The more coins you own, the more of a discount you get on trading fees.
- Voting rights for new coin additions. Huobi Token holders have a say in which new coins are added to the platform through voting rights. Similar to trading fees discounts, the more tokens you own, the more say you get over which new coins are added to the platform
- It can be used for premium services and airdrops. Huobi Token can be used to pay for premium services and receive airdrops of new coins. This makes holding HT tokens beneficial, especially to investors or traders wanting new tokens.
- Linked to the performance of the exchange. The token’s success is closely tied to the performance of the Huobi Global exchange. This means that the value of each token will rise and fall in line with the exchange’s success. If the Huobi Global exchange gains popularity, its token value will likely increase.
- Direct response to the success of Binance coin. Huobi Token is a response to the success of Binance coin and serves as a utility token for the Huobi Global exchange.
- Competition in the cryptocurrency space. The cryptocurrency space is becoming increasingly competitive, with many platforms vying for customers, including established and decentralised exchanges. This means that users have a choice, which could be a negative for the HT token if other platforms are more popular.
